Why I like it:Unbounce's Smart Traffic feature sets it apart from every other landing page builder on this list. Instead of manually running A/B tests and waiting weeks for statistical significance, Smart Traffic uses AI to route each visitor to the variant most likely to convert them, and it starts working with as few as 50 visits. The platform is mature, reliable, and integrates with everything. The downside is that Smart Traffic requires the $249/month Optimize plan, which makes it a hard sell for smaller budgets.

Why I like it:Instapage is the landing page builder I recommend for PPC-heavy teams and agencies. The AdMap feature lets you visualize your entire ad-to-page funnel and ensure every ad has a matching, personalized landing page. Built-in heatmaps are a standout feature that saves you from paying for a separate analytics tool like Hotjar. The collaboration tools make it practical for teams where multiple people touch the same campaigns. The main drawback is that the best features sit behind the more expensive plans.

What Landing Page Builders Do (And When You Need One)

Every marketing campaign needs a destination, and your website homepage is not it. A landing page is a standalone page designed for one specific goal: getting visitors to take a single action, whether that is signing up for a newsletter, downloading a guide, or buying a product.

Landing page builders let you create these focused pages without touching code. Most come with drag-and-drop editors, pre-designed templates, and built-in conversion tools like A/B testing and form builders. Some go further with AI optimization, heatmaps, and dynamic content personalization.

You need a dedicated landing page builder when your regular website builder makes it difficult to create focused, distraction-free pages. If you are running paid ads (Google Ads, Facebook Ads, Instagram Ads), sending traffic to a general website page is one of the most common and costly mistakes. A purpose-built landing page matched to your ad copy will consistently convert 2-5x better than a generic page.

Even if you are not running ads, landing pages are essential for email opt-ins, webinar registrations, product launches, and seasonal promotions. The builders in this guide range from enterprise-grade platforms with AI optimization to simple tools that cost less than $2 per month.

A website builder (like Wix or Squarespace) creates full websites with navigation, multiple pages, and general content. A landing page builder creates focused, single-purpose pages designed for one specific conversion goal. Landing page builders include conversion-specific features like A/B testing, dynamic text replacement, and form analytics that most website builders lack.

WordPress can create landing pages with plugins, but dedicated builders offer drag-and-drop editing, built-in A/B testing, and faster page load times without the overhead of managing themes and plugins. If you run paid ads or need to launch pages quickly, a dedicated builder pays for itself through better conversion rates and saved time.

A strong headline that matches your ad or traffic source, a clear call-to-action above the fold, social proof (testimonials, logos, numbers), fast load times (under 3 seconds), and minimal distractions (no navigation menu, no competing links). A/B testing different headlines and CTAs can improve conversions by 20-50% over time.

AMP (Accelerated Mobile Pages) landing pages load nearly instantly on mobile devices, which can improve Quality Score and reduce cost-per-click in Google Ads. If mobile traffic makes up a significant portion of your ad spend, AMP pages from tools like Swipe Pages are worth testing. The trade-off is slightly less design flexibility.
